草庐IT

关于node.js:AWS Linking Dynamo DB 和 S3 bucket

AWSLinkingDynamoDBandS3bucket我正在创建一个跟踪公司潜在员工的项目。我想将一些pdf文件上传到AWSS3存储桶。我想在现有的dynamoDB表中存储每个pdf的链接(每个pdf一条记录)。任何建议将不胜感激。我正在动态生成新用户,并希望能够同时将pdf添加到存储桶和dynamoDB中的链接。我可以同时通过lambda函数执行此操作吗?您希望Lambda函数上传到S3的PDF文件在哪里?pdf将在一个人的本地计算机上。PDF如何进入您的应用程序?您是在编写用户上传PDF的无服务器(基于Lambda)网络应用程序,还是其他?显然,您可以将PDF存储到S3并从相同的代码写

关于amazon s3:Rails Generate controller aws error missing bucket name

RailsGeneratecontrollerawserrormissingbucketname我正在尝试在我的ruby??onrails项目中创建一个用户控制器,我还配置了heroku和aws-s3存储桶。我使用S3_BUCKET、AWS_ACCESS_KEY_ID和AWS_SECRET_ACCESS_KEY设置了我的.env和heroku本地。我还将我的初始化程序/aws.rb文件设置为如下所示:123456Aws.config.update({ region:'us-east-1', credentials:Aws::Credentials.new(ENV['AWS_ACCESS_KEY

关于amazon s3:Rails Generate controller aws error missing bucket name

RailsGeneratecontrollerawserrormissingbucketname我正在尝试在我的ruby??onrails项目中创建一个用户控制器,我还配置了heroku和aws-s3存储桶。我使用S3_BUCKET、AWS_ACCESS_KEY_ID和AWS_SECRET_ACCESS_KEY设置了我的.env和heroku本地。我还将我的初始化程序/aws.rb文件设置为如下所示:123456Aws.config.update({ region:'us-east-1', credentials:Aws::Credentials.new(ENV['AWS_ACCESS_KEY

关于 python:使用 AWS Lambda / CloudFormation 转换 AWS Kinesis Firehose 中的数据

TransformingdatainAWSKinesisFirehosewithAWSLambda/CloudFormation我在AWS博客上找到了本指南,其中举例说明了我正在尝试完成的工作。我目前有一个看起来像KinesisStream-->KinesisFirehose-->S3存储桶的工作流,我想引入一个Lambda,我可以在其中转换数据,然后再到达最终目的地。首先,Lambda蓝图的链接不适用于该文章。也不是Firehose中数据转换的官方文档。有人有这个案例的可用Python蓝图吗?其次,该指南显示,在AWS控制台中创建Firehose传输流时,Lambda中有一个"启用"数据转换

关于 python:使用 AWS Lambda / CloudFormation 转换 AWS Kinesis Firehose 中的数据

TransformingdatainAWSKinesisFirehosewithAWSLambda/CloudFormation我在AWS博客上找到了本指南,其中举例说明了我正在尝试完成的工作。我目前有一个看起来像KinesisStream-->KinesisFirehose-->S3存储桶的工作流,我想引入一个Lambda,我可以在其中转换数据,然后再到达最终目的地。首先,Lambda蓝图的链接不适用于该文章。也不是Firehose中数据转换的官方文档。有人有这个案例的可用Python蓝图吗?其次,该指南显示,在AWS控制台中创建Firehose传输流时,Lambda中有一个"启用"数据转换

关于 php:Amazon AWS 每个用户的权限

AmazonAWSPermissionsPerUser我正在尝试找出一种方法来授予用户上传到我的存储桶的文件的打开/下载权限。我正在阅读:亚马逊S3存储桶策略-限制引用者访问但不限制是否通过查询字符串身份验证生成url,并使用它来实现基于引用的下载,但我试图做的是:用户A上传文件,只有用户A和root可以访问该文件。用户B上传文件,只有用户B和root可以访问该文件。我已经在每个文件的元数据中添加了一个帐户ID。是否可以将其用于身份验证?运行if($s3->get_object_metadata(\\'account_id\\',$file))==\\'123\\'{provideaccess

关于 php:Amazon AWS 每个用户的权限

AmazonAWSPermissionsPerUser我正在尝试找出一种方法来授予用户上传到我的存储桶的文件的打开/下载权限。我正在阅读:亚马逊S3存储桶策略-限制引用者访问但不限制是否通过查询字符串身份验证生成url,并使用它来实现基于引用的下载,但我试图做的是:用户A上传文件,只有用户A和root可以访问该文件。用户B上传文件,只有用户B和root可以访问该文件。我已经在每个文件的元数据中添加了一个帐户ID。是否可以将其用于身份验证?运行if($s3->get_object_metadata(\\'account_id\\',$file))==\\'123\\'{provideaccess

关于亚马逊 s3:在 AWS Lambda 中解析 SQS 消息触发器 – Python

ParseSQSmessagetriggerinAWSLambda-Python我收到关于S3存储桶上传的通知,以将消息放入SQS队列。SQS队列触发一个lambda函数。我正在尝试从触发lambda函数的SQS消息中提取上传的文件的名称。当打印到CloudWatch日志时,我的SQS事件记录如下所示:1234567891011121314151617181920212223242526272829303132333435363738{"Records":[  {    "eventVersion":"2.1",    "eventSource":"aws:s3",    "awsRegion

关于亚马逊 s3:在 AWS Lambda 中解析 SQS 消息触发器 – Python

ParseSQSmessagetriggerinAWSLambda-Python我收到关于S3存储桶上传的通知,以将消息放入SQS队列。SQS队列触发一个lambda函数。我正在尝试从触发lambda函数的SQS消息中提取上传的文件的名称。当打印到CloudWatch日志时,我的SQS事件记录如下所示:1234567891011121314151617181920212223242526272829303132333435363738{"Records":[  {    "eventVersion":"2.1",    "eventSource":"aws:s3",    "awsRegion

关于 java:Unable to load AWS credentials from any provider in the chain in Docker EC2 env

UnabletoloadAWScredentialsfromanyproviderinthechaininDockerEC2env我已经对一个使用AmazonSQS的Javaspring-boot(v1.4.2)应用程序进行了docker化(通过spring-cloud-starter-aws-messagingv1.1.3引入了aws-java-sdk-sqsv1.11.18)。现在要提供对AWS的应用程序访问,我遵循以下模式:12345678  @Bean  publicAmazonSQSAsyncamazonSQSAsync(){    AWSCredentialscredentials